1. A microfluidic device for performing integrated reaction and separation operations, comprising:

  • a body structure having an integrated microscale channel network disposed therein;

    a reaction region within the integrated microscale channel network, the reaction region having a mixture of at least first and second reactants disposed in and flowing through the reaction region, the mixture interacting to produce one or more products, wherein the reaction region comprises a first fluid having a first conductivity to maintain contact between the first and second reactants flowing therethrough; and

    a separation region in the integrated channel network, the separation region in fluid communication with the reaction region and comprising a separation inducing buffer having a second conductivity that is lower than the first conductivity to separate the first reactant from the one or more products flowed therethrough.
